Smash Television

Smash Television 1 (also known as Smash or Smash TV1) is a Maltese television station. Smash is privately owned and maintains a neutral editorial position in which different opinions on Maltese politics are expressed. It remains much smaller than the older stations.[1]

History

On 11 February 2009, when Smash TV2 was launched, Smash TV was rebranded as Smash TV1.
